MediaTek's upcoming Dimensity 9400 falls short of Snapdragon 8 Gen 4's speculated performance, packs moderate GPU improvements, according to reliable tipster
The internet has been abuzz with rumors regarding MediaTek's upcoming Dimensity 9400 chipset, with expectations pointing towards a continuation of their collaboration with ARM for CPU and GPU designs. Renowned tipster Digital Chat Station has provided insights into the specifications, shedding light on the upcoming flagship SoC's expected CPU and GPU performance
According to Digital Chat Station's previous disclosures on Weibo, the Dimensity 9400 will incorporate a configuration comprising one Cortex-X5 and three Cortex-X4 cores, based on TSMC's 2nd-generation 3 nm 'N3E' lithography. Additionally, the leaker now claims the chipset is anticipated to showcase the new ARM Immortalis-G9XX series GPU, a successor to the Immortalis-G720 featured in the Dimensity 9300.
While specifics regarding the Immortalis GPU model remain undisclosed, speculations by DCS hint at the possibility of it being labeled as the Immortalis-G920. Initial performance evaluations, however, suggest a rather modest improvement over its predecessor. Reports from GFXBench Aztec benchmarks indicate a 12 percent increase in performance, with the Dimensity 9400 achieving 110FPS compared to the Dimensity 9300's 99FPS. Nonetheless, these scores must be taken with a grain of salt, given how unreliable benchmarks can be on unreleased hardware.
Further insights from alleged Geekbench 6 scores reveal promising performance metrics for the Dimensity 9400, with a single-core score of 2,700 and multi-core scores nearing the 10,000 mark, a significant step up from the Dimensity 9300's multi-core score of around 7,500. Although falling short of the Snapdragon 8 Gen 4's rather shocking rumored multi-core performance, MediaTek strides towards significant generational improvements, even keeping up with the desktop-class Apple M3, signifying a notable advancement in smartphone processing power.
